well that could be tricky... say usa loses 0-1, they remain at 4 for total goals n zero in GD but Ghana wins 2-1... GD for USA n Ghana is at -0- but total goals then becomes USA 4 - Ghana 5(3+2)......

Correct. USA holds the H2H tiebreaker in case

USA 0 - Germany 1

Ghana 1 - Portugal 0


Ghana/USA GD = 0-0

Ghana/USA GS = 4-4

H2H = USA


That's why if the USA loses they need to lose by 1, and the USA/GER score needs to be a reverse of a Ghana victory.

Like this:
Ghana 3 - Portugal 2

Germany 3 - USA 2


Ghana GD = 0 - GS = 6 (3+3) GA = 6 (4+2)

USA GD = 0 - GS = 6 (4+2) GA = 6 (3+3)

If Ghana wins by 2+ scores or Ghana wins while USA loses by 2+ goals allowed, USA loses their tiebreaking edge and are knocked out.


Luckily, this can all be avoided with a USA draw or victory.
